Family-focused: 12 Quinlan Court, Werribee, 3030

A hop, skip and jump from Werribee River’s walking tracks, five-minute ambles from Galvin Park and an off-leash dog park and a short drive from Pacific Werribee and the train station, this property couldn’t be in a better locale for a busy, active family.

Manorvale Primary School and Wyndham Central Secondary College are less than a kilometre away.

 

12 Quinlan Court, Werribee, 3030

 

Beyond a minimal-upkeep garden, entry under a porch is to a wide floorboarded entry hall with decorative columns defining entry to a grey-carpeted lounge room. This has soft-grey wall paint and white accents – the same palette that characterises most rooms.

Across the way, the main bedroom has walk-through robes and a spacious en suite with inset oval spa tub.

The other three fitted bedrooms share a rear hallway with sparkling main bathroom and separate toilet.

The spacious living hub has a meals zone set in a wide bay. The kitchen has an island bench beneath industrial-style pendants, plenty of white cupboards and stainless-steel dishwasher, wall oven and gas cooktop.

A big, carpeted rumpus room with garden views adjoins the living hub. It’s the ideal spot for family movie watching or setting up a pool table.

The appealing alfresco area, partly sheltered via a brush mat-covered pergola, has wooden seating and paved and lawned areas for kicking back in the sunshine.

A spacious lawn is fenced off for kids and pets to romp in safety.

The property has ducted heating and evaporative cooling, a large garden shed and a drive-through double garage. The block is about 605 square metres.
